Data set added in Release #19, Dec 2012, based on Fasoli et al (2012)

Fasoli et al (2012). The Grapevine Expression Atlas Reveals a Deep Transcriptome Shift Driving the Entire Plant into a Maturation Program. The Plant Cell Online. doi: 10.1105/tpc.112.100230

Background: The authors developed a genome-wide transcriptomic atlas of grapevine (Vitis vinifera) based on 54 samples representing green and woody tissues and organs at different developmental stages as well as specialized tissues such as pollen and senescent leaves. Together, these samples expressed ∼91% of the predicted grapevine genes.

To identify and characterize organ-specific genes, the authors constructed a reduced 38-sample data set, excluding from the analysis samples with redundant organ identity and those collected during senescence and withering (see Supplemental Data Set 2)

Annotations based on Supplemental Data Set 2: Organ-specific transcripts_S2

The 38 samples were mapped to PO ids representing the plant structures and plant growth stages used.
